The Samsung Galaxy J2 Prime (SM-G532F) remains a widely used budget smartphone. However, users frequently encounter system errors like bootloops, "Custom Binary Blocked by FRP," or network registration failures.
In the world of mobile repair, a "patch" often refers to fixing a broken (International Mobile Equipment Identity) or restoring network connectivity when a device shows "Emergency Calls Only" or "Not Registered on Network". If you recently unlocked your SM-G532F or changed its official firmware, the network certificate may get broken. Even with a valid SIM card inserted, the phone will refuse to make calls or connect to mobile data. The patch file restores the network certificate signature. 2.
